ORDINANCE NO. 838
A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F
POWAY, CALIFORNIA, APPROVING SPECIFIC PLAN
AMENDMENT 19-001 TO THE SOUTH POWAY SPECIFIC PLAN
TO ALLOW SELF -STORAGE BUILDINGS TO CONTAIN A
MAXIMUM OF THREE STORIES WITHIN THE EXISTING
HEIGHT ALLOWANCE
WHEREAS, Chapter 17.47 (Specific Plan Regulations) of Title 17 (Zoning Development
Code) of the Poway Municipal Code provides the requirements for the initiation, preparation, and
adoption of Specific Plans in accordance with Section 65450, et seq. of the California Government
Code (Article 8, Specific Plan);
WHEREAS, Specific Plan Amendment (SPA) 19-001, in association with Development
Review (DR) 19-003, is proposed to allow self -storage buildings to contain a maximum of three
stories within the existing height allowance;
WHEREAS, on January 7, 2020, the City Council held a duly advertised public hearing to
solicit comments from the public, both in favor and against SPA19-001; and
WHEREAS, the City Council has read and considered the agenda report for the proposed
project and has considered other evidence presented at the public hearing.
NOW, THEREFORE, TH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F POWAY DOES ORDAIN
AS FOLLOWS:
SECTION 1: The above recitations are true and correct.
SECTION 2: An Environmental Impact Report (EIR) was prepared pursuant to the
California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) in conjunction with the South Poway Specific Plan
SPSP), and was certified on July 30, 1985, and the Final Subsequent EIR was certified on July
26, 1988. The SPSP EIR analyzed the potential impacts of the proposed build out of the SPSP
area in the manner permitted by the SPSP. The proposed SPA is consistent with the SPSP and
conforms with the requirements, development standards and guidelines therein, and, therefore,
as set forth in Chapter 10, Section VIII of the SPSP, no further environmental analysis is required
because the project's impacts have already been analyzed and are fully covered by the previously
certified EIR. The increase in the allowed number of stories from two to three within the existing
maximum height requirements for self -storage buildings does not impact the aesthetics because
the allowed building heights will remain the same. Additionally, there are no significant changes
proposed that would require subsequent or supplemental environmental review pursuant to Public
Resources Code section 21166 and CEQA Guidelines sections 15162 and 15163.
SECTION 3: The City Council hereby approves this Ordinance (SPA19-001), in
association with DR19-003, and amends certain sections of the SPSP as specified below.
Removals are indicated with strikethroughs and additions are indicated with underline.
SECTION 4: Chapter 3, Section IV, Subsection A, Item 3(f) of the SPSP Volume 2 shall
be amended as follows:
3. Height [Excerpt only]
f. The maximum height of a public storage structure shall not exceed 35 feet. No more
than three stories shall be contained within the 35 -foot height limit.
